River Kwai & Jungle Adventure


Experience the real Thailand


This trip is packed full of activities and experiences to give you an insight into traditional Thai life. We stay in raft houses on the famous River Kwai, walk through dense rainforest and experience the warm hospitality of local villagers in their homes. We try a little bit of everything: from cookery to cycling and cities to beaches.

14 day tour itinerary


Day 1 Join tour Bangkok. Option to view the city’s stilt houses in longtail boats along the klongs (canals). Day 2 Bangkok Visit the Grand Palace then create a delicious Thai curry in a cookery lesson. Days 3/4 Raft houses Stay in raft houses fl oating on the River Kwai. Enjoy bamboo rafting and cycle through the jungle to limestone caves. Day 5 “Death Railway” Visit the railway near Kanchanaburi that was constructed by Japanese prisoners of war. Take a sleeper train south. Days 6/7 Jungle experience In Khao Sok National Park, ride elephants through lush rainforest to a nearby waterfall and take a guided walk. Days 8/9 Homestay Stay with Thai

families for two days and experience daily village life where fi shing and farming is a way of life. Days 10/13 Koh Samui Relax with plenty of free time on this paradise island. Take a boat trip into the Ang Thong Marine National Park for snorkelling and swimming. Fly to Bangkok. Day 14 Tour ends Bangkok.
